AI Technical Summary

Technical Problem

Under prolonged resonance, the irregular movement of the balls inside the bearing in the motor end cover leads to increased friction and wear. The fixing bolts at the connection between the inner and outer end covers become loose, affecting the normal use of the motor.

Method used

The anti-resonance motor end cover adopts a split design. A protective mechanism, including a damper and a spring, is set between the inner end cover and the bearing housing. The outer end cover and the inner end cover are connected by a reinforcing rib. The damping alloy material and the reinforcing rib structure reduce vibration transmission and avoid resonance.

Benefits of technology

It effectively reduces the vibration and noise levels of the motor end cover, improves the motor's operational stability and reliability, facilitates disassembly and maintenance, and reduces overall costs.

Abstract

The utility model discloses a split type anti-resonance motor end cover, and relates to the technical field of motor end covers. The split type anti-resonance motor end cover comprises an outer end cover, an inner end cover and a bearing seat arranged in the inner end cover, a motor shaft is fixedly connected with the inner wall of the bearing seat, and reinforcing ribs are arranged between the outer end cover and the inner end cover. According to the device, the motor end cover is made of a damping alloy material, so that the transmission of vibration can be effectively weakened, the damper and the spring are arranged between the inner end cover and the bearing seat, and the end cover is not easy to resonate with the vibration of the motor by utilizing the damping material and a vibration reduction structure, so that the vibration and noise level is effectively reduced; the motor end cover is effectively protected, the reinforcing ribs are arranged between the outer end cover and the inner end cover, resonance is further prevented, and the overall quality of the motor end cover is improved.

Description

Technical Field

[0001] This utility model relates to the field of motor end cover technology, specifically a split-type anti-resonance motor end cover. Background Technology

[0002] In industrial production, many automated devices require motors for driving, such as those in machine tools and conveyor belts. If the motors vibrate excessively during operation, it will not only affect the processing accuracy and operational stability of the equipment, but may also lead to equipment failure. Using a split-type anti-resonance motor end cover can improve the operational reliability of the motor. The split-type anti-resonance motor end cover is mainly composed of an inner end cover and an outer end cover. The inner end cover is coupled to the motor shaft through a bearing seat set inside it.

[0003] When the motor is running, the rotation of the motor output shaft will generate continuous vibration. Over time, the end cover connected to it will resonate under its influence. Since the motor shaft is connected to the inner end cover through bearings, under normal circumstances, there is a relatively stable rotational contact between the inner and outer rings and the balls of the bearing. However, under resonance, this contact becomes abnormally violent, and the balls will jump irregularly in the raceway, which greatly increases the friction and wear between the various components of the bearing. At the same time, the fixing bolts at the connection between the inner end cover and the outer end cover will also loosen, causing misalignment between the motor end cover and the motor, affecting the normal use of the end cover. In view of the shortcomings of the existing technology, we propose a split anti-resonance motor end cover to solve the above problems. Utility Model Content

[0028] This utility model discloses a split-type anti-resonance motor end cover.

[0029] According to the appendix Figure 1-7As shown, it includes an outer end cover 1, an inner end cover 2, and a bearing seat 3 disposed inside the inner end cover 2. The outer end cover 1 and the inner end cover 2 constitute an anti-resonance motor end cover. The motor shaft is fixedly connected to the inner wall of the bearing seat 3. The inner end cover 2 is mainly made of damping alloy materials, which can effectively reduce the transmission of vibration. The outer end cover 1 is mainly made of aluminum alloy materials, which, while ensuring a certain strength of the outer end cover 1, helps to reduce the overall weight of the outer end cover 1.

[0030] See attached document Figure 2-7 A protective mechanism 4 is provided between the inner end cover 2 and the bearing housing 3. This protective mechanism 4 dampens vibrations between the bearing housing 3 (connected to the motor shaft) and the inner end cover 2, preventing strong resonance between the anti-resonance motor end cover and the motor. The protective mechanism 4 includes protective plates 41, with multiple sets of protective plates 41 disposed inside the inner end cover 2. All protective plates 41 are made of damping alloy material, and one side of each set of protective plates 41 is fixedly connected to the outer wall of the bearing housing 3. A damper 42 is disposed between one side of the protective plate 41 and the inner wall of the inner end cover 2. The outer surface of the damper 42... A spring 43 is provided on the wall. One end of the spring 43 is connected to the inner wall of the inner end cover 2, and the other end of the spring 43 is connected to one side of the protective plate 41. The vibration characteristics of the motor end cover are changed by using damping material, damper 42 and spring 43. For example, the damping material can convert vibration energy into other forms of energy such as heat energy and dissipate it. The damper and spring 43 can cut off the direct transmission path of vibration from the motor rotor to the end cover, making it less likely for the end cover to resonate with the vibration of the motor, thereby effectively reducing the vibration and noise level and effectively protecting the motor end cover.

[0031] See attached document Figure 2-5 The outer end cover 1 has an end hole 11 on one side for positioning and installing the inner end cover 2. The connecting component 44 is disposed between the outer end cover 1 and the inner end cover 2. The connecting component 44 enables convenient disassembly and assembly between the outer end cover 1 and the inner end cover 2, and allows undamaged parts to be reused multiple times. The connecting component 44 includes a positioning plug 441 fixedly connected to one side of the inner end cover 2, a positioning seat 442 fixedly connected to the outer wall of the outer end cover 1, and a positioning screw 44 for locking the connection between the positioning plug 441 and the positioning seat 442. 3. Both the positioning plug 441 and the positioning seat 442 are made of sealing material. The outer end cover 1 and the inner end cover 2 are designed separately. When it is necessary to inspect or maintain the inside of the motor, the positioning screw 443 can be removed from the positioning plug 441 and the positioning seat 442 by rotating the positioning screw 443. Then the inner end cover 2 and the outer end cover 1 can be easily removed, which is convenient for operators to operate inside the motor. In addition, when the inner end cover 2 or the outer end cover 1 is damaged, the undamaged parts can be reused, which effectively reduces the overall cost.

[0032] See attached document Figure 4-5 A first reinforcing rib 5 is fixedly installed between the inner wall of the outer end cover 1 and the outer wall of the inner end cover 2. A second reinforcing rib 6, corresponding to the position of the first reinforcing rib 5, is fixedly installed on the outer wall of the inner end cover 2. The first and second reinforcing ribs 5 and 6 effectively increase the overall support strength of the combined inner end cover 2 and outer end cover 1, allowing the multiple sets of reinforcing ribs to better withstand these forces and prevent deformation and cracking of the motor end cover due to stress. In particular, when the natural frequency of the motor end cover is close to the vibration frequency of the motor, resonance will occur, leading to a sharp increase in vibration and noise. The multiple sets of reinforcing ribs can adjust the mass distribution and stiffness characteristics of the motor end cover, thereby changing... Its natural frequency avoids resonance. At the same time, multiple sets of reinforcing ribs can also disperse vibration energy to a certain extent. When vibration is transmitted to the motor end cover, multiple sets of reinforcing ribs can disperse the vibration energy throughout the entire motor end cover structure, reduce local vibration concentration, further reduce vibration amplitude, and improve motor stability. A locking screw 62 is rotatably provided on one side of the first reinforcing rib 5 for connecting and fixing the first reinforcing rib 5 and the second reinforcing rib 6. A slot 61 is opened at one end of the first reinforcing rib 5 for positioning and installing the second reinforcing rib 6, so that the connection position between the inner end cover 2 and the outer end cover 1 can be positioned through the first reinforcing rib 5 and the second reinforcing rib 6.
